One of the primary reasons for carrying out bookkeeping in building jobs is the need for economic control and monitoring. Construction jobs frequently call for significant investments in labor, materials, equipment, and various other resources. Proper bookkeeping enables stakeholders to keep an eye on and handle these funds effectively. Bookkeeping systems offer real-time understandings into project costs, profits, and profitability, enabling project managers to promptly identify potential concerns and take rehabilitative activities.


Accountancy systems make it possible for companies to check capital in real-time, making certain adequate funds are available to cover expenditures and meet economic responsibilities. Effective capital administration aids stop liquidity situations and keeps the job on track. https://giphy.com/channel/pvmaccounting. Building jobs undergo different economic mandates and reporting needs. Appropriate accounting makes sure that all financial deals are taped accurately and that the job adheres to audit criteria and legal arrangements.

A Construction Accounting professional is in charge of taking care of the monetary elements of building and construction tasks, consisting of budgeting, cost monitoring, economic reporting, and compliance with governing needs. They work very closely with task supervisors, service providers, and stakeholders to guarantee precise monetary documents, price More about the author controls, and timely payments. Their proficiency in building and construction accounting principles, project costing, and monetary analysis is necessary for effective monetary management within the construction sector.

Pay-roll tax obligations are taxes on a worker's gross wage. The profits from payroll tax obligations are used to money public programs; as such, the funds gathered go straight to those programs instead of the Internal Revenue Service (IRS).


Note that there is an added 0.9% tax for high-income earnersmarried taxpayers that make over $250,000 or single taxpayers making over $200,000. There is no employer suit for this included tax. Federal Unemployment Tax Act (FUTA). Earnings from this tax obligation go toward government and state joblessness funds to aid employees that have actually shed their work.

Your deposits should be made either on a month-to-month or semi-weekly schedulean political election you make prior to each fiscal year. Regular monthly payments. A regular monthly settlement should be made by the 15th of the complying with month. Semi-weekly payments. Every various other week deposit dates depend on your pay schedule. If your payday falls on a Wednesday, Thursday or Friday, your deposit schedules Wednesday of the complying with week.
